  • Patent number: 5873385
    Abstract: A check valve 10 for a fluid passageway 12 or 14 of a pressure balancer 16 or the like, and having a base plate 40 with an opening 62 therethrough connected in the passageway 12 or 14. The underside 42 of the base plate 40 disposed in the passageway 12 or 14 to face normal flow therein and the upperside 44 facing the opposite direction. A substantially "U" shaped frame member 79 is connected on the upperside 44 of the base plate 40. The frame member 79 carries two leg members 52 and 54 extending from the upperside 44 of the base plate 40 on opposite sides of the opening 62 with a bridge member 72 carried by the leg members 52 and 54 to span the opening 62. A closure member 92 is disposed on the upperside 44 of the base plate 40 adjacent the opening 62. A spring member 80 is connected between the frame member 79 and the closure member 92 normally to urge the closure member 92 to close the opening 62 whenever the flow in the passageway 12 or 14 is less than 5 psi.

  • Patent number: 5871320
    Abstract: A retaining device for securing insulation to sheet metal has a flange, an articulated structure and a push plate having an aperture therethrough such that when the retainer, except for the flange, is inserted in a hole in the insulation layer it allows a push plate to be pushed towards the flange, causing a pair of locking fingers to pivot and press up against the underside of the insulation in a locked position. The retaining device is then frictionally fitted over a stud member on the sheet metal to which the insulation layer is to be secured.

  • Patent number: 5865473
    Abstract: In a water flow system, a non-metallic liner 50 is placed within at least a portion of a passage 48 of a supporting metallic end body 38 to preclude contact between any water flowing through the system and the passage of the end body. The liner 50 includes a flared section 60 at a first end 54 thereof which engages a bevelled surface 49 of the end body 38 and is held there in sealing fashion by a cone washer 82 and a nut 84 threadedly coupled to the end body. At a location near a second end 56 of the liner 50, the liner is formed with a first stepped shoulder 62 which facilitates location of the liner within the passage 48 of the end body 38 at the second end of the liner. A second stepped shoulder 64 is formed on the liner 50 which provides a location for an O-ring 72 which engages an adjacent portion of the passage 48 of the end body to form a seal thereby.

  • Patent number: 5857365
    Abstract: An electronically operated lock has a latch mechanism which is operable by a rotatable spindle. The spindle can be rotated manually either by an inside turn lever or a key operated outside plug or rotated electronically. A pinion is secured to the spindle and a slider supported for vertical displacement has a vertical rack which cooperates with the pinion. The slider has vertically separated upper and lower control surfaces and a rotatable wheel gear has an eccentric axially extending finger located intermediate the upper and lower control surfaces. The wheel gear is driven by a single direction motor through gearing.

  • Patent number: 5839464
    Abstract: A cartridge valve 116 includes a fixed disk 80 and a movable disk 118 mounted in a housing 66. A lever 46 extends through a major opening 72 axially located at one end of the valve 116. The lever 46 is attached to a coupler 130 for facilitating movement of the movable disk 118 relative to the fixed disk 80 to control the flow and temperature of water passing through the valve 116. A flexible valve 144 is attached to the coupler 130 and, in normal use of the valve 116, prevents holes 136 formed therethrough from communicating with a passage formed through the movable disk 118. Air from the environment surrounding the valve 116 can enter the major opening 72, and upon the occurrence of a negative pressure in the water supply, will flex the valve 144 to allow air to enter the supply line to negate the undesirable effects thereof. In another cartridge valve 160, holes 166 are formed through the side wall of the housing 66 to provide further air communication through the holes 136 of the coupler 130.

  • Patent number: 5834728
    Abstract: The invention relates to a process for the application of components strung together in the manner of a belt onto workpieces in which the components are intermittently brought successively into a separating position for a respective component. The component halted in the separating position is initially grasped by a spatially movable jointing tool brought to the separating position over a free path, the jointing tool being held in its position defined by the halted component, the grasped component then severed from the subsequent component and is finally transferred by the jointing tool into the respectively desired jointing position remote from the separating position, in which the component is fastened on the workpiece, for example by electric arc welding.
